After fighting criticism coming in from most quarters over the poor performance of the Aakash tablet, both in terms of its build quality and usability, the government today revealed that a better version of the tablet is expected to come out in April, this year. HRD Minister, Kapil Sibal who has been the force behind the entire project was quoted as saying, "In order to cater to the huge demand, we need several manufacturers to manufacture Aakash. We are enhancing the specifications on the basis of feedback we have received from the first version of Aakash. So we want to make sure that the upgraded product caters to the need of the customers… We have involved ITI in order to upgrade it… We will be able to bring in Aakash-II by April."
